IDebugFunctionPosition2IDebugFunctionPosition2

Esta interfaz representa una posición abstracta de una función de un documento de origen.This interface represents an abstract position of a function in a source document.

SintaxisSyntax

IDebugFunctionPosition2 : IUnknown  

Notas para los implementadoresNotes for Implementers

El motor de depuración (Alemania) implementa esta interfaz para representar la posición de una función dentro de un documento de origen.The debug engine (DE) implements this interface to represent the position of a function within a source document.

Notas para los llamadoresNotes for Callers

Esta interfaz se suministra como parte de un BP_LOCATION union (en concreto, un BP_LOCATION_CODE_FUNC_OFFSET estructura) que a su vez forma parte de la BP_REQUEST_INFO estructura que se utiliza en la creación de un punto de interrupción pendiente.This interface is supplied as part of a BP_LOCATION union (specifically, a BP_LOCATION_CODE_FUNC_OFFSET structure) that is in turn part of the BP_REQUEST_INFO structure, used in creating a pending breakpoint.

Métodos en orden de VtableMethods in Vtable Order

La tabla siguiente muestran los métodos de IDebugFunctionPosition2.The following table shows the methods of IDebugFunctionPosition2.

MétodoMethod DescripciónDescription
GetFunctionNameGetFunctionName Obtiene el nombre de la función que esta posición será relativa a.Gets the name of the function that this position is relative to.
GetOffsetGetOffset Obtiene el desplazamiento desde el principio de la función.Gets the offset from the beginning of the function.

ComentariosRemarks

En concreto, la posición representada por esta interfaz es la basado en texto, un TEXT_POSITION estructura.The position represented by this interface is text-based, specifically, a TEXT_POSITION structure.

RequisitosRequirements

Encabezado: msdbg.hHeader: msdbg.h

Namespace: Microsoft.VisualStudio.Debugger.InteropNamespace: Microsoft.VisualStudio.Debugger.Interop

Ensamblado: Microsoft.VisualStudio.Debugger.Interop.dllAssembly: Microsoft.VisualStudio.Debugger.Interop.dll

Vea tambiénSee Also

Interfaces de núcleo Core Interfaces
BP_LOCATION_CODE_FUNC_OFFSET BP_LOCATION_CODE_FUNC_OFFSET
BP_LOCATION BP_LOCATION
TEXT_POSITIONTEXT_POSITION